Step 1: Click the bottom left corner of your screen, start menu icon. No program is open, you do so. This will eliminate clutter, and make it easier to find what you need.
Step Two: Right click "My Computer" in your Start menu. (Vista users should right-click "Computer" from the pop-up menu, select "Properties.")
The third step: find the Hardware tab, click "Device Manager." (Vista users can click the left menu in the "Device Manager" Properties window. You do not have to click on a tab. Click "Continue" when prompted.)
Step 4: Select the type of item you want to find an updated driver. For example, if you select "Display Adapters", it will expand and show all of your computer display adapters. If you check for updates on all your equipment, start at the top and work all the way down.
Step Five: Right-click the specific device to update your PC drivers. Select "Update Driver" from the pop-up menu. This will open the Hardware Update Wizard.
Step Six: Choose the button next to "Yes, this is just" let the wizard connect to the Internet, and update your device drivers search. Click "Next."
Step Seven: stay in the "Install the software automatically" setting selected (if not selected, select it to switch). Click "Next." The wizard will now search for new drivers and install automatically if we find any. If your device is up to date, it will tell you it can not find a better driver for your device.
Step Eight: Click "Finish." Repeat steps 4 through 7 for each device on each extension option to update your PC on all the drivers.
